Output 381ecd3d4f27b1779641ab9e844265d88057481e4b34dc8574128e85fe9cd43f:1

value
621288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ae0780db37208202f737c4bffd828e33ded7d73 OP_EQUALVERIFY OP_CHECKSIG
address
17puuaBiDLh17ivMCSpSEc7HYRBws1pEzF
transaction
381ecd3d4f27b1779641ab9e844265d88057481e4b34dc8574128e85fe9cd43f
spent
true